Caesar’s Pasta, LLC of Blackwood, NJ is recalling 5,610 lbs. of frozen manicotti because of potential Listeria monocytogenes.

The recall was the result of a routine sampling program, which revealed that the finished products might contain bacteria.

The frozen manicotti was sold to various foodservice distributors, and distributed to restaurants

A Texas company has recalled cheese stuffed shells after laboratory tests showed Listeria monocytogenes in the finished product.

Garland Ventures Ltd. of Garland, TX, has stopped production of the implicated product, according to a company recall notice posted by the Food and Drug Administration.

D’Orazio Foods of Bellmawr, NJ, is recalling approximately 161,000 pounds of frozen stuffed pasta products that were produced without federal inspection, the U.S. Department of Agriculture’s Food Safety and Inspection Service (FSIS) said Thursday.
